5.0 out of 5 stars Perfetto! Just plain great., February 13, 2004
This review is from: Saeco Magic Cappuccino Espresso and Cappuccino Machine (Kitchen)
This is a really good machine for those who want some seriously good espresso but can't quite bring themselves to spend 800 dollars+ for a fully automatic machine. It heats up quickly and produces FANTASTIC espresso with thick crema. Only a few minor problems:

Frothing milk is difficult- but if you only drink espresso its well worth it.
Plastic Case- I love metal.
Pump- works great, but its a *tad* noisy (only a tad)
Instructions- worthless. Like italian translated to japanese translated to farsi translated to english. But easy to use.

Dont pass this great great machine by! Im so happy and caffeinated now its like a different person.

This review is from: Saeco Magic Cappuccino Espresso and Cappuccino Machine (Kitchen)
Magic will do fine if you put up with Saeco's quirks and maintain it correctly. The machine WILL leak water from the steam nozzle. Some have a flimsy plastic water tank. You must clean the brewhead monthly,and don't leave the machine on for long periods . Flush out the steam wand and disassemble and clean after every use. De- Calcify regularly if you have hard water. Follow these tips and it will serve you well for years(mine are 6 and 2 years old). I've tried several times to upgrade to more expensive machines and have always gone back to the Saeco's.
